A free route airspace project initiated by HungaroControl, Hungary’s air navigation service provider, is a finalist in the World ATM Congress’ Maverick Awards for the flexibility it has given airlines and subsequent fuel savings.
Enaire, Spain’s air navigation service provider (ANSP), has devised a tool to monitor the shortcuts air traffic controllers steer flights on in a bid to save time and fuel, thus enabling an impact assessment of the more direct routings.
